C05C0063 • Install the refrigerator in the most cool part of the room, out of direct sunlight and Energy Saving Ideas away from heating ducts or registers. Do not place the refrigerator next to heat- producing appliances such as a range, oven or dishwasher. If this is not possible, a section of cabinetry or an added layer of insulation between the two appliances will help the refrigerator operate more efficiently. • Level the refrigerator so the doors close tightly. • Refer to this Owner's Guide

Shelf Adjustment Fresh Food Storage Refrigerator shelves are easily adjusted to suit individual needs. Before adjusting shelves, remove all food. The shipping clips which stabilize the shelves for shipping may be removed and discarded. To adjust the cantilever shelves (shelves supported at the rear of the refrigerator), lift the back of the shelf up and out. Replace shelf by inserting hooks at rear into slots. Keep your refrigerator and freezer clean to prevent odor build-up. Wipe up any spills Care and Cleaning immediately and clean both sections at least twice a year. Never use metallic scouring pads, brushes, abrasive cleaners or strong alkaline solutions on any surface. Do not wash any removable parts in a dishwasher. Always unplug the power cord from the wall outlet before cleaning. NOTE: Turning the control to OFF does not disconnect power to the controls, light bulb, or other electrical compone

Long vacations: Care and Cleaning * Remove all food and ice if you will be gone 1 month or more. (continued) * Turn controls to OFF and disconnect power. * Turn off automatic ice maker and turn water supply valve to the closed position. * Clean interior thoroughly. Leave both doors open to prevent odor and mold build-up. Block open if necessary.
